Syllabus of AIEEA PG 2018 for a B.Tech agriculture student is mentioned below:
For Agricultural Engineering and Technology:
Soil & Water Conservation Engineering/Soil & Water Engineering, Irrigation Drainage engineering /Irrigation Water Management Engineering, Post Harvest Technology/ Processing and Food Engineering/ Farm Machinery and Power Engineering and Renewable Energy Engineering.

Admission to B.Sc. in Medical Imaging Technology from Acharya Institute of Health Sciences is based on the marks obtained in 10+2/ Diploma. Minimum Eligibility to Apply is a pass percentage of 50% in class 12 with Mandatory Subjects :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, English, Biology.
Other eligibility criteria:
Candidates having Diploma in Medical Imaging Technology with 50% marks after 10th or O Level from any recognized board are also eligible to apply.
Interested candidates can apply online with required information.
